
Infant Swimming Resource’s proprietary Self-Rescue® program is a 4-6 week course, scheduled 5 days per week, Monday through Friday, for 10 minutes each day.
With a focus on safe, customized, one-on-one lessons by Certified Instructors, we emphasize health, ongoing program evaluations and parent education to deliver the most effective and safest results in the industry. Children may begin lessons as young as 6 months of age.
Lessons for your 6 – 12 month old are focused on teaching your child to roll onto their back to float, rest and breathe, and to be able to maintain this life-saving position until help arrives.
Lessons for your older child focus on teaching the swim-float-swim sequence. Children learn to swim with their head down, roll onto their back, rest and breathe, and roll back over to resume swimming until they reach the edge of the pool, where they can either crawl out or wait until help arrives.
Once the children are fully skilled they will practice ISR’s survival techniques fully clothed during lessons. It is recommended that children complete refresher lessons to help their in-water skill level grow with their physical development.
